The legal letter Rose Hanbury’s team sent Stephen Colbert might just be a slap on the wrist. Attorney Neama Rahmani shared with Us Weekly that the talk show host didn’t accuse Hanbury and Prince William of anything damaging, but was merely repeating the rumors that were already out there. “We’re not saying that it’s absolutely true that Rose had an affair with William or putting out a definitive statement because of the nuanced nature of what Colbert said,” Rahmani stated, adding that Hanbury doesn’t have a “good defamation case.”

Regardless of the letter’s outcome, Hanbury, who was given the nickname “Camilla 2.0” by the internet, is reportedly not happy about having her reputation sullied. “I know people who know the Marchioness of Cholmondeley very, very well, and she absolutely was not having an affair with the Prince of Wales,” royal expert Nick Bullen also told Us Weekly. He added, “Even when those rumors broke a few years ago, she was very upset by them then. She’s still very upset by them now.”
